` Роль протокола BGP (Border Gateway Protocol) в управлении IP-адресами - Interlir networks marketplace
bgunderlay bgunderlay bgunderlay

Роль протокола BGP (Border Gateway Protocol) в управлении IP-адресами

В современном взаимосвязанном мире эффективное управление интернет-трафиком является критически важным для интернет-провайдеров (ISP), крупных предприятий и других организаций, управляющих значительными IP-сетями. Центральным игроком в этом ландшафте является протокол Border Gateway Protocol (BGP), который позволяет принимать решения о маршрутизации в Интернете. BGP служит основой для направления трафика между автономными системами (ASes) и управления обширной сетью используемых сегодня IP-адресов.

В этой статье мы рассмотрим фундаментальную роль BGP в управлении IP-адресами, проблемы, которые он решает, и его значение для интернет-провайдеров и предприятий.

Что такое BGP?

BGP — это основной протокол, используемый для обмена информацией о маршрутизации между различными ASes, которые представляют собой совокупность IP-сетей, управляемых одной или несколькими организациями, которые представляют единую политику маршрутизации в Интернете. BGP позволяет этим ASes взаимодействовать и определять наилучшие пути для маршрутизации трафика.

Протокол BGP поддерживает два типа ключей:

  1. Внешний BGP (eBGP): Используется для обмена информацией о маршрутизации между различными AS.
  2. Внутренний BGP (iBGP): Используется в пределах одной AS для распространения информации о внешней маршрутизации.

Процесс принятия решений в этом протоколе основан на множестве факторов, включая длину пути, политику AS и производительность сети. BGP позволяет сетям динамически адаптироваться к изменяющимся условиям, обеспечивая эффективную передачу трафика в глобальной сети Интернет.

Роль BGP в управлении IP-адресами

Управление маршрутизацией между ASes

Одной из основных функций BGP является поддержка связи между ASes, что позволяет предприятиям и интернет-провайдерам эффективно маршрутизировать трафик. BGP управляет таблицей маршрутизации IP-адресов, обеспечивая направление пакетов данных по наиболее оптимальному пути к месту назначения.

В средах, где организация или интернет-провайдер контролирует несколько AS, BGP помогает обеспечить бесперебойную связь, обмениваясь информацией о маршрутизации между этими системами. Это особенно важно для крупных сетей с распределенной инфраструктурой, где надежное управление трафиком имеет решающее значение.

Мультихоминг и резервирование

Мультихоминг — это подключение к нескольким интернет-провайдерам для обеспечения избыточности и балансировки нагрузки. BGP играет важную роль в этом контексте, поскольку он управляет маршрутами и обеспечивает распределение трафика между различными соединениями таким образом, чтобы оптимизировать производительность и отказоустойчивость.

Способность BGP динамически маршрутизировать трафик между несколькими интернет-провайдерами снижает риск простоя из-за отказа одного провайдера. Бизнес выигрывает от такого резервирования, гарантируя, что его онлайн-услуги останутся доступными для пользователей, даже если у одного провайдера возникнут проблемы с подключением.

Распределение и агрегация IP-адресов

Эффективное управление пространством IP-адресов становится все более сложной задачей, поскольку ресурсы IPv4 становятся все более ограниченными, а внедрение IPv6 остается неполным. BGP помогает в распределении IP-адресов путем агрегирования маршрутных объявлений, уменьшая размер глобальных таблиц маршрутизации.

Группируя несколько IP-адресов в одном объявлении BGP, он минимизирует нагрузку на маршрутизаторы и обеспечивает более эффективную обработку трафика. Этот процесс, известный как «агрегация маршрутов» или «агрегация префиксов», позволяет провайдерам рекламировать меньший набор IP-префиксов, что делает глобальное управление IP-адресами более масштабируемым.

Проблемы безопасности в BGP

Несмотря на свои сильные стороны, BGP не лишена проблем, особенно в сфере безопасности. BGP был разработан с минимальными функциями безопасности, что делает его восприимчивым к таким атакам, как перехват маршрута, когда злоумышленники неправильно направляют трафик, чтобы получить доступ к конфиденциальным данным или нарушить работу сервисов.

Чтобы снизить эти риски, провайдерам и предприятиям рекомендуется принять ряд мер и усовершенствовать систему безопасности:

  1. Фильтрация маршрутов BGP: Помогает ограничить влияние неправильных или вредоносных объявлений о маршрутизации, применяя строгие правила фильтрации к обновлениям BGP.
  2. Инфраструктура открытых ключей ресурсов (RPKI): Обеспечивает криптографическую проверку информации о маршрутизации для предотвращения перехвата маршрутов.
  3. Взаимосогласованные нормы безопасности маршрутизации (MANRS): Глобальная инициатива, направленная на повышение безопасности маршрутизации BGP за счет совершенствования методов работы.

Эти меры безопасности необходимы для поддержания доверия к глобальной инфраструктуре маршрутизации и обеспечения ответственного и безопасного управления IP-адресами.

Практические примеры использования BGP на предприятиях

Роль BGP в управлении трафиком для крупных организаций не ограничивается интернет-провайдерами. Предприятия с разветвленными глобальными сетями также полагаются на BGP для обеспечения эффективного потока трафика и управления IP-адресами. Вот несколько практических примеров использования:

Пример использованияОписание
Балансировка нагрузки на трафикBGP позволяет организациям балансировать трафик между несколькими центрами обработки данных, оптимизируя производительность и использование ресурсов.
Восстановление после катастрофПредприятия используют BGP для перенаправления трафика в случае сбоя в работе одного из своих центров обработки данных, поддерживая непрерывность бизнеса.
Глобальное управление интеллектуальной собственностьюBGP помогает управлять глобальными IP-ресурсами, позволяя предприятиям консолидировать информацию о маршрутизации для эффективной работы.
VPN и частные сетиBGP также используется в виртуальных частных сетях (VPN) для обеспечения безопасной маршрутизации данных между различными подразделениями предприятия.

Эти примеры использования показывают, как предприятия могут использовать BGP для эффективного управления IP-адресами и обеспечения надежной работы сети.

Заключение

BGP играет ключевую роль в глобальном управлении IP-адресами, поддерживая обширную сеть ASes в Интернете. Его способность динамически маршрутизировать трафик, управлять распределением IP-адресов и обеспечивать резервирование делает его незаменимым как для интернет-провайдеров, так и для предприятий. Однако с учетом растущего значения кибербезопасности защита BGP с помощью таких мер, как RPKI и фильтрация маршрутов, имеет решающее значение для поддержания целостности управления IP-адресами.

Поскольку организации продолжают расширять свою цифровую инфраструктуру, BGP будет оставаться фундаментальным инструментом для оптимизации управления IP-адресами, обеспечения эффективной маршрутизации трафика и поддержания стабильности глобального интернета.

Alexander Timokhin

COO

    Ready to get started?

    Статьи
    InterLIR: Брокер IPv4-адресов и рынок сетевых решений
    InterLIR: Брокер IPv4-адресов и рынок сетевых решений

    InterLIR GmbH — это площадка, которая стремится решить

    More
    Перераспределение IP-пространства
    Перераспределение IP-пространства

    Эффективное использование существующего адресного

    More
    Гид по регистрации ASN
    Гид по регистрации ASN

    Мир интернет-соединений и управления сетями

    More
    Различие между VLSM и CIDR
    Различие между VLSM и CIDR

    В огромном и сложном мире сетевых технологий

    More
    Текущие тенденции на рынке передачи IPv4
    Текущие тенденции на рынке передачи IPv4

    В мире сетевых технологий ценность и спрос на

    More
    Использование данных о местоположении IP-адресов для улучшения сетевого взаимодействия
    Использование данных о местоположении IP-адресов для улучшения сетевого взаимодействия

    «Использование данных о местоположении IP-адресов

    More
    Понимание и получение автономных системных номеров (ASN)
    Понимание и получение автономных системных номеров (ASN)

    В огромном и взаимосвязанном мире интернета

    More
    Расшифровка обратного DNS (rDNS)
    Расшифровка обратного DNS (rDNS)

    В эпоху цифровых технологий, где каждое онлайн-взаимодействие

    More
    Внедрение NAT: ключевые преимущества и стратегии сетевого взаимодействия
    Внедрение NAT: ключевые преимущества и стратегии сетевого взаимодействия

    Сетевое преобразование адресов (NAT) — это средство

    More
    Что такое WHOIS: дешифровка цифрового каталога
    Что такое WHOIS: дешифровка цифрового каталога

    В необъятном мире цифровых технологий знание

    More